Henry A. Goehring, 90, of Lodi, died Tuesday morning in his home after a brief illness.
Mr. Goehring was a native of South Dakota and farmed there. He joined the Army during World War I. After the war, he moved to Acampo where he was also a farmer.
He married Magdalena Schnaidt in 1926, while living in Lodi. She died in October 1967.
In 1968, Mr. Goehring married Bertha Zimbelman and he also retired from farming.
He was a member of the American Legion Post No. 22, Lodi.
In addition to his first wife, Magdalena Goehring, he was preceded in death by two brothers.
